2.6.2. ABTS radical scavenging activity
The ABTS assay was proposed by Re et al. (1999). ABTS radical
was produced by reacting 2 mL of 7 mM ABTS solution with 1 mL
of 7.35 mM potassium persulfate in the dark at room temperature
for 12 h. The resulting solution was diluted with 5 mM phosphate
buffer (pH 7.4) to obtain an absorbance in the range of 0.68–0.72 at
734 nm. Stock solutions of aqueous alcohol extracts were diluted
1:30 (v/v) with methanol to produce sample solutions, while stock
solutions of ethyl acetate and water extracts were diluted 1:10 (v/v)
with methanol. Then, diluted ABTS•+ solution (4.85 mL) was mixed
with 150 L of sample solution. The absorbance was recorded
immediately after 6 min at 734 nm.
